英語での「ascend」の定義と意味

to ascend
01

登る, 上昇する

to move upward or climb to a higher position or elevation
Transitive: to ascend a sloping surface
to ascend definition and meaning
example
o reach the summit, the trail runners had to ascend a series of switchbacks.
頂上に到達するために、トレイルランナーは一連のスイッチバックを登る必要がありました。
02

登る, 上る

to slope or incline upward
Intransitive
to ascend definition and meaning
example
The winding path ascends gently through the forest, revealing breathtaking views at every turn.
曲がりくねった道は森の中をゆっくりと登り、曲がるたびに息をのむような景色を現します。
03

登る, 上昇する

to move upward
Intransitive: to ascend | to ascend somewhere
example
The hot air balloon slowly ascended into the morning sky.
熱気球はゆっくりと朝の空に上昇しました
04

遡上する, 流れに逆らって進む

to travel or move against the flow of a river
Transitive: to ascend a water current
example
The salmon diligently ascend the river to reach their spawning grounds.
サケは産卵場に到達するために熱心に川を上ります
05

上昇する, 昇進する

to rise in status, rank, or position within a social or professional hierarchy
Intransitive: to ascend | to ascend to a position or rank
example
After years of hard work, she finally ascended to the position of CEO in the company.
何年もの努力の末、彼女はついに会社のCEOの地位に上り詰めました
06

登る, 継ぐ

to take over or inherit the position of a ruler
Intransitive
Transitive: to ascend a throne
example
The young prince was set to ascend to the throne after the passing of his father, the king.
若い王子は、父である王の死後、王位に就くことになっていた。
07

遡る, 辿る

to go back through records, genealogies, routes, or other chronological references
Transitive: to ascend through records and references
example
In the study of ancient civilizations, researchers ascend through archaeological findings.
古代文明の研究において、研究者は考古学的発見を通じて遡ります
